Use separate representations for canonical repository vs. commit (#317)

Given `https://github.com/pypa/package.git#subdirectory=pkg_a` and
`https://github.com/pypa/package.git#subdirectory=pkg_b`, we want these
to map to the same shared _resource_ (for locking and cloning), but
different _packages_ (for determining whether the wheel already exists
in the cache). As such, we need two distinct concepts for "canonical
equality".

/// Resolve two packages from a `requirements.in` file with the same Git HTTPS dependency.
#[test]
fn compile_git_concurrent_access() -> Result<()> {
let temp_dir = assert_fs::TempDir::new()?;
let cache_dir = assert_fs::TempDir::new()?;
let venv = temp_dir.child(".venv");
Command::new(get_cargo_bin(BIN_NAME))
.arg("venv")
.arg(venv.as_os_str())
.arg("--cache-dir")
.arg(cache_dir.path())
.current_dir(&temp_dir)
.assert()
.success();
venv.assert(predicates::path::is_dir());
let requirements_in = temp_dir.child("requirements.in");
requirements_in.touch()?;
requirements_in
.write_str("example-pkg-a @ git+https://github.com/pypa/sample-namespace-packages.git@df7530eeb8fa0cb7dbb8ecb28363e8e36bfa2f45#subdirectory=pkg_resources/pkg_a\nexample-pkg-b @ git+https://github.com/pypa/sample-namespace-packages.git@df7530eeb8fa0cb7dbb8ecb28363e8e36bfa2f45#subdirectory=pkg_resources/pkg_b")?;
insta::with_settings!({
filters => INSTA_FILTERS.to_vec()
}, {
assert_cmd_snapshot!(Command::new(get_cargo_bin(BIN_NAME))
.arg("pip-compile")
.arg("requirements.in")
.arg("--cache-dir")
.arg(cache_dir.path())
.env("VIRTUAL_ENV", venv.as_os_str())
.current_dir(&temp_dir));
});
Ok(())
}
